数据可信度的未来趋势与发展

96 阅读8分钟

1.背景介绍

数据可信度是指数据的准确性、完整性、及时性、可靠性和有用性等多种方面的表达。随着数据规模的增加,数据可信度的要求也越来越高。在大数据时代,数据可信度成为了企业和组织的核心竞争力。因此,研究数据可信度的未来趋势和发展具有重要的理论和实践价值。

1.1 数据可信度的重要性

数据可信度是指数据的准确性、完整性、及时性、可靠性和有用性等多种方面的表达。随着数据规模的增加,数据可信度的要求也越来越高。在大数据时代,数据可信度成为了企业和组织的核心竞争力。因此,研究数据可信度的未来趋势和发展具有重要的理论和实践价值。

1.2 数据可信度的挑战

随着数据规模的增加,数据可信度的要求也越来越高。但是,数据可信度的挑战也越来越大。这主要有以下几个方面:

  1. 数据质量问题:数据来源不可靠、数据处理过程中出现错误等问题可能导致数据质量下降,从而影响数据可信度。

  2. 数据安全问题:数据泄露、数据盗用等问题可能导致数据安全性下降,从而影响数据可信度。

  3. 数据处理能力问题:数据处理量越来越大,传统的数据处理方法已经无法满足需求,需要开发新的数据处理技术来提高数据可信度。

  4. 数据存储能力问题:随着数据规模的增加,数据存储能力也面临挑战,需要开发新的数据存储技术来提高数据可信度。

因此,研究数据可信度的未来趋势和发展具有重要的理论和实践价值。

2.核心概念与联系

2.1 数据可信度的核心概念

数据可信度的核心概念包括:

  1. 数据准确性:数据是否准确地反映了实际情况。

  2. 数据完整性:数据是否缺失或损坏。

  3. 数据及时性:数据是否及时更新。

  4. 数据可靠性:数据是否来源可靠。

  5. 数据有用性:数据是否能够满足需求。

这些概念是数据可信度的基础,只有数据可信度高,数据才能被信任和使用。

2.2 数据可信度与数据质量的关系

数据可信度和数据质量是紧密相关的。数据质量是指数据是否符合预期的准确性、完整性、及时性、可靠性和有用性等多种方面的标准。数据可信度是指数据是否能够满足需求,是数据质量的一个重要指标。因此,提高数据可信度,就必须关注数据质量。

2.3 数据可信度与数据安全的关系

数据可信度和数据安全是紧密相关的。数据安全是指数据是否受到保护,不被未经授权的人访问、篡改或披露。数据可信度是指数据是否能够满足需求,是数据安全的一个重要指标。因此,提高数据可信度,就必须关注数据安全。

3.核心算法原理和具体操作步骤以及数学模型公式详细讲解

3.1 核心算法原理

在研究数据可信度的未来趋势和发展时,需要关注的核心算法原理包括:

  1. 数据清洗算法:用于去除数据中的噪声、错误和缺失值,提高数据质量。

  2. 数据加密算法:用于保护数据安全,防止数据被未经授权的人访问、篡改或披露。

  3. 数据处理算法:用于处理大量数据,提高数据处理能力。

  4. 数据存储算法:用于存储大量数据,提高数据存储能力。

这些算法原理是提高数据可信度的基础。

3.2 具体操作步骤

具体操作步骤包括:

  1. 数据清洗:

    1. 数据预处理:将原始数据转换为可以进行分析的格式。

    2. 数据清洗:去除数据中的噪声、错误和缺失值。

    3. 数据转换:将数据转换为可以进行分析的格式。

  2. 数据加密:

    1. 数据加密:将数据加密,防止数据被未经授权的人访问、篡改或披露。

    2. 数据解密:将数据解密,使授权人员能够访问和使用数据。

  3. 数据处理:

    1. 数据聚合:将多个数据源合并为一个数据集。

    2. 数据挖掘:从数据中发现隐藏的模式和规律。

    3. 数据分析:对数据进行深入的分析,以获取有价值的信息。

  4. 数据存储:

    1. 数据存储:将数据存储在数据库或其他存储设备中。

    2. 数据备份:将数据备份到多个存储设备中,以防止数据丢失。

    3. 数据恢复:从备份中恢复数据,以防止数据损坏或丢失。

3.3 数学模型公式详细讲解

数据可信度的数学模型公式可以用来计算数据可信度的值。公式为:

C=111R×1Q×1T×1SC = \frac{1}{1 - \frac{1}{R} \times \frac{1}{Q} \times \frac{1}{T} \times \frac{1}{S}}

其中,C表示数据可信度,R表示数据准确性,Q表示数据完整性,T表示数据及时性,S表示数据可靠性,1 - R、1 - Q、1 - T和1 - S分别表示数据准确性、完整性、及时性和可靠性的缺失值。

4.具体代码实例和详细解释说明

4.1 数据清洗代码实例

import pandas as pd

# 读取数据
data = pd.read_csv('data.csv')

# 数据清洗
data = data.dropna()  # 去除缺失值
data = data.replace(np.nan, 0, regex=True)  # 将缺失值替换为0
data = data.replace('N/A', 0, regex=True)  # 将N/A替换为0

4.2 数据加密代码实例

from cryptography.fernet import Fernet

# 生成密钥
key = Fernet.generate_key()

# 加密数据
cipher_suite = Fernet(key)
encrypted_data = cipher_suite.encrypt(b'data')

# 解密数据
decrypted_data = cipher_suite.decrypt(encrypted_data)

4.3 数据处理代码实例

from sklearn.cluster import KMeans

# 数据处理
kmeans = KMeans(n_clusters=3)
data['cluster'] = kmeans.fit_predict(data[['feature1', 'feature2', 'feature3']])

4.4 数据存储代码实例

import sqlite3

# 数据存储
conn = sqlite3.connect('data.db')
data.to_sql('data', conn, if_exists='replace')
conn.close()

5.未来发展趋势与挑战

未来发展趋势与挑战主要有以下几个方面:

  1. 数据可信度的提高:随着数据规模的增加,数据可信度的要求也越来越高。因此,需要开发新的数据清洗、数据加密、数据处理和数据存储技术来提高数据可信度。

  2. 数据安全的提升:随着数据规模的增加,数据安全性也面临挑战。因此,需要开发新的数据安全技术来保护数据安全。

  3. 数据处理能力的提升:随着数据规模的增加,传统的数据处理方法已经无法满足需求。因此,需要开发新的数据处理技术来提高数据处理能力。

  4. 数据存储能力的提升:随着数据规模的增加,数据存储能力也面临挑战。因此,需要开发新的数据存储技术来提高数据存储能力。

  5. 数据可信度的评估:随着数据规模的增加,数据可信度的评估也变得越来越复杂。因此,需要开发新的数据可信度评估方法来评估数据可信度。

6.附录常见问题与解答

6.1 数据可信度与数据质量的关系

数据可信度和数据质量是紧密相关的。数据质量是指数据是否符合预期的准确性、完整性、及时性、可靠性和有用性等多种方面的标准。数据可信度是指数据是否能够满足需求,是数据质量的一个重要指标。因此,提高数据可信度,就必须关注数据质量。

6.2 数据可信度与数据安全的关系

数据可信度和数据安全是紧密相关的。数据安全是指数据是否受到保护,不被未经授权的人访问、篡改或披露。数据可信度是指数据是否能够满足需求,是数据安全的一个重要指标。因此,提高数据可信度,就必须关注数据安全。

6.3 数据可信度的评估方法

数据可信度的评估方法主要有以下几种:

  1. 数据准确性评估:使用数据准确性评估指标,如精度、召回率和F1分数等,来评估数据准确性。

  2. 数据完整性评估:使用数据完整性评估指标,如缺失值率和数据冗余度等,来评估数据完整性。

  3. 数据及时性评估:使用数据及时性评估指标,如延迟和响应时间等,来评估数据及时性。

  4. 数据可靠性评估:使用数据可靠性评估指标,如可用性和故障恢复时间等,来评估数据可靠性。

  5. 数据有用性评估:使用数据有用性评估指标,如数据的重要性和数据的相关性等,来评估数据有用性。

这些评估方法可以帮助我们更好地评估数据可信度,并提高数据可信度。